

The annual Labor Day Road Race is a family-friendly Macon tradition. Both the 5K and 10K races feature a fast, point-to-point course that finish with a run through downtown Macon and into Central City Park where cheering fans, fun, and fellowship await you. Run the 10K to get a good qualifier for next year's Peachtree. Participants receive technical fabric wicking shirts, with women's cut shirts for the ladies. Team Competitions:
For both the 5K and the 10K, awards will be given to the top 3 Teams of
Five (at least 2 members must be female); top 3 Parent/Child teams; and
top 3 Husband/Wife teams. Each person may only sign up for one
team, but all team members will still be eligible for overall & age
group awards. Awards will be determined by combined
times. All team members must run the same race (5K or 10K).

Course Description: The courses overlap. The 10-K race begins ½
mile east of Wesleyan College, following Forsyth Road as it turns into Vineville Avenue. At the 3.1 mile mark, the 5-K begins, close to
the intersections of Vineville, Pio Nono, and Pierce Avenues, in front
of the Vineville Baptist Church. Both races proceed across I-75,
where the road changes names to Forsyth Street, then Cotton Avenue.
This road will turn sharply right and left as you pass City Hall,
continuing to Second Street where you will turn left. You turn
right onto Walnut Street, left onto Seventh Street, and right into
Central City Park. Major hills are located at the ½ mile mark of
the 10-K and the 4.5 mile mark of the 10-K (1.2 mile mark of the 5-K).
Otherwise, the course is relatively flat or downhill except for a few
small inclines.
